Olu Bryki Raum is a Finnish craft brewery with roots dating back to 2007. Since 2021, the brewery has been proudly operating in the historic coastal town of Rauma known for its rich maritime culture and wooden old town.
What makes Olu Bryki Raum truly unique is its dedication to ancient beer traditions. It is the only brewery in the world focused exclusively on brewing beers based on pre-1000 AD methods and styles.
Specializing in Sahti, one of the world’s oldest beer styles, Olu Bryki Raum preserves a nearly forgotten part of Finnish cultural heritage. Sahti is a traditional Finnish farmhouse ale brewed without hops and flavored with juniper, offering a rich, smooth, and distinctive taste. It is typically unfiltered and naturally fermented.


Once central to rural Finnish life, the Sahti tradition has nearly disappeared. Luckily Olu Bryki Raum is committed to keeping tradition alive.
In addition to its ancient beers, the brewery produces high-quality, small-batch craft beers inspired by both local character and international styles. Through tastings and storytelling, visitors can experience authentic Finnish craft beer culture and enjoy a rare taste of Finland’s living brewing history.
